Stressful Aspects
Hard aspects occur when two planets form a challenging angle with each other. The most common hard aspects include squares (90 degrees apart) and oppositions (180 degrees apart). These angles create tension between the planets, resulting in conflict, obstacles, and challenges for individuals who have these aspects in their birth chart.
This tension often manifests as internal struggles or external obstacles that require individuals to navigate complex situations. For instance, a square aspect between Mars and Saturn might indicate difficulties in asserting oneself or reaching goals due to feelings of restriction or self-doubt. Similarly, an opposition between the Moon and Sun can create a push-and-pull dynamic between one's emotional needs and one's conscious identity.

In contrast to hard aspects are soft aspects like trines (120 degrees apart) and sextiles (60 degrees apart), which generally signify ease and harmony between planetary influences. However, while soft aspects bring comfort—and sometimes complacency—the presence of hard aspects is crucial for deep transformation; they incite action where stagnation might otherwise prevail.
